Once again, after a previous failed attempt to divest myself of Canon Rumors. I'm trying again. Hopefully this go doesn't result in a year of legal insanity. Nothing against lawyers, but they don't make anything easy or stress free.
I have agreed once again sell the site.
This company owns a bunch of sites in our little niche, so I don't foresee the same problems that I previously had to deal with. The process will take between 12 - 18 months. In that time, there will be a lot of changes to the site. A lot of those changes will be seen in the next 2-6 months. I have already given up 95% of backend autonomy. I will also be giving up social, mailing, design/UI and those sorts of things in the near future.
There will now be a team of 8-10 people dealing with each aspect of Canon Rumors. These sorts of endevours have long been overwheling for a single person to handle, and I never wanted to manage people in this business. I'm not a great teacher and take things personally for better or worse. That has lead to some mental health episodes that weren't great for the site, but they did lead to finally getting a handle on my brain and life.
I don't want to sit at a desk anymore and would like to do something else, which I have wanted to do for years now. A new dream if you will. It won't make me rich, but I can't wait to start.
That said, it's been 17 years of relationship building, so I will likely be around in some capacity to provide certain types of information. That will be about the extent of my involvement once this entire process is completed.
January 2008 this site came to be as something to do other than play World of Warcraft, though I really did have a badass Druid (For the Horde!). That's a long time in an industry that has changed so much. A lot of the friends I made have long since moved on and we have this "influencer" thing that I simply don't relate to, and never want to relate to.
A few years ago I was out, and thought I was out, but here were are. Though since that time, this site has become a better place to hang out. The moderators have done a great job getting rid of the terrible people that riddled this forum and my inbox. I think they all shoot Sony now.
No, the site won't become some AI trainwreck of rubbish. This is a real company that will be evolving the site. The core of Canon Rumors will remain intact, that's why people are here to begin with. There could be so much more though.
I will update before a major change to the site is coming.
